Installing a gas boiler in London involves more than connecting the boiler to the gas supply. The installation must meet Gas Safety Regulations, Building Regulations, manufacturer requirements and applicable standards.

This guide answers the key questions homeowners, landlords and tenants ask about gas boiler installation regulations in London, including Gas Safe requirements, flue rules, condensate pipes, ventilation, boiler location, certificates, new installations and replacement boilers.

Do I Need a Gas Safe Engineer to Install a Boiler?

Yes.

Gas boiler installation is regulated gas work and must be carried out by an appropriately qualified Gas Safe registered engineer.

The engineer should:

  • Check the boiler and installation requirements
  • Assess the gas supply
  • Install the boiler
  • Install the flue correctly
  • Connect the condensate system
  • Complete safety checks
  • Test the appliance
  • Commission the boiler
  • Provide the required documentation

Never use an unregistered person for gas boiler installation.

What Regulations Apply to Gas Boiler Installation in London?

The main requirements include:

  • Gas Safety (Installation and Use) Regulations
  • Building Regulations
  • Boiler manufacturer’s installation instructions
  • Applicable British Standards
  • Gas Safe requirements
  • Energy-efficiency requirements
  • Requirements for the boiler flue and condensate discharge

The exact requirements depend on the property, boiler and type of installation.

Is Gas Safe Registration Mandatory?

Yes.

Gas work covered by the Gas Safety (Installation and Use) Regulations must be carried out by an engineer who is appropriately registered with Gas Safe.

Before booking an installer, check that they are registered and qualified for the specific gas work required.

Does a New Boiler Need Building Regulations Approval?

Yes, gas boiler installations are subject to Building Regulations.

A suitably registered installer can generally self-certify applicable work through a Competent Person Scheme instead of requiring the homeowner to arrange Building Control separately.

The appropriate compliance notification should be completed after the installation.

Do I Get a Boiler Installation Certificate?

After installation, you should receive the appropriate documentation confirming the work.

Depending on the installation, this can include:

  • Building Regulations compliance notification
  • Boiler commissioning documentation
  • Manufacturer’s warranty documentation
  • Gas safety documentation where applicable

Keep these documents for future servicing, repairs or property sale.

What Are the Boiler Flue Regulations?

The flue safely removes combustion gases from the boiler.

It must:

  • Be suitable for the boiler
  • Be correctly installed
  • Be adequately supported
  • Discharge combustion products safely
  • Meet applicable clearance requirements
  • Follow the manufacturer’s instructions
  • Comply with relevant regulations and standards

There is no single clearance distance that applies to every boiler flue. The required clearance depends on the flue type and its position.

Can a Boiler Flue Go Through a Wall?

Yes.

Many modern condensing boilers use a horizontal flue through an external wall.

However, the flue position must meet the applicable clearance requirements.

The engineer needs to consider nearby:

  • Windows
  • Doors
  • Ventilation openings
  • Eaves
  • Roofs
  • Boundaries
  • Adjacent buildings
  • Air intakes
  • Public areas

The boiler manufacturer’s instructions must also be followed.

Can a Gas Boiler Be Installed in a Bedroom?

Potentially, yes.

Modern room-sealed boilers can be installed in certain bedrooms when the boiler, flue and installation meet the relevant requirements.

The proposed location should be assessed by the installer before installation.

Can a Boiler Be Installed in a Bathroom?

Potentially, but the exact location matters.

The installation must comply with the relevant gas, electrical and manufacturer’s requirements.

Electrical zones and protection requirements can also apply in bathrooms.

A qualified installer should assess the proposed position before installation.

Does a Gas Boiler Need Ventilation?

It depends on the type of boiler.

Most modern room-sealed condensing boilers take combustion air from outside through the flue system and generally don’t require the same room ventilation as older open-flued appliances.

However, requirements vary depending on the appliance and installation.

Do not block or remove an existing ventilation opening without professional advice.

What Are the Condensate Pipe Requirements?

Modern condensing boilers produce acidic condensate that must be safely discharged.

The condensate pipe should:

  • Be correctly sized
  • Have suitable falls where required
  • Be properly connected
  • Be protected against freezing where necessary
  • Discharge into an appropriate waste system

External condensate pipework requires particular attention because freezing can cause the boiler to shut down.

Can the Boiler Condensate Pipe Go Outside?

Yes, where the installation is designed appropriately.

However, external condensate pipework needs suitable protection against freezing.

Where practical, installers may use an internal route to reduce freezing risk.

The final arrangement should follow the manufacturer’s instructions and applicable requirements.

Does a New Boiler Need a Carbon Monoxide Alarm?

CO alarm requirements depend on the appliance and installation.

Where a carbon monoxide alarm is required, it should be correctly positioned and installed according to the applicable requirements and manufacturer’s instructions.

Can a Boiler Be Installed in a Cupboard?

Yes, potentially.

A boiler can be installed inside a cupboard when:

  • The boiler is suitable for the location
  • Manufacturer clearances are maintained
  • The flue can be installed correctly
  • Required access is available
  • Ventilation requirements are met where applicable
  • The boiler can be safely serviced

Do not build or modify a cupboard around a boiler without checking the manufacturer’s requirements.

Gas Boiler Replacement Regulations

Replacing an existing boiler can be more straightforward than installing a completely new heating system, but the existing installation still needs to be assessed.

The installer should check:

  • Existing flue
  • Gas supply
  • Boiler location
  • Condensate pipe
  • Heating controls
  • Radiator system
  • Electrical supply
  • Existing safety arrangements
  • New boiler manufacturer’s requirements

A new boiler should not simply be connected to an existing installation without checking its suitability.

Do I Need to Upgrade My Gas Pipe for a New Boiler?

Possibly.

The required gas supply depends on the boiler’s input and the existing installation.

The engineer may assess:

  • Gas meter
  • Gas pipe size
  • Pipe length
  • Appliance load
  • Existing gas appliances
  • Gas pressure

If the existing supply isn’t adequate, modifications may be required.

Does a New Boiler Need New Heating Controls?

Modern boiler installations have specific requirements relating to heating controls and energy efficiency.

Depending on the existing system, the installer may need to consider:

  • Programmer
  • Room thermostat
  • Time and temperature controls
  • Thermostatic radiator valves
  • Weather compensation
  • Smart controls

The exact requirements depend on the system and applicable regulations.

Is Boiler Installation Different in a London Flat?

It can be.

London flats can have additional considerations such as:

  • Limited external-wall access
  • Communal flues
  • Difficult condensate routes
  • Leasehold restrictions
  • Freeholder requirements
  • Managing-agent approval
  • High-rise building considerations
  • Listed or converted buildings

If you live in a flat, check whether your landlord, freeholder or managing agent requires permission before changing the heating system.

Can I Install a Gas Boiler Myself?

No.

Gas boiler installation involves regulated gas work and must be carried out by an appropriately qualified Gas Safe registered engineer.

DIY gas boiler installation can create serious risks, including gas leaks, carbon monoxide exposure, fire, explosion and unsafe combustion.

Always use a Gas Safe registered professional.
